Who better to lead you in St Patrick Day's celebrations than charismatic singer Fiona McElroy, over from Ireland for the weekend to front her band Big Mama's Door. Widely acclaimed by peers and audiences as hugely entertaining and engaging. Big Mama's Door play their brand of Sexy 50's RnB, jazz and soul with a whole lot of professionalism and love to sold out venues. They play an eclectic mix of originals and covers. Fronted by the most authentic and charismatic Fiona McElroy, who is backed by an excellent band comprising Andy Knight on guitar, Martin Dewhirst on sax, Stephen Walsh on piano and the Shaw siblings Francesca and Bradley on double bass and drums.
